Sponsor Statement for SB 215 An Act relating to licensing common carriers to dispense alcoholic beverages; and providing for an effective date.
The purpose of SB 215 is to reduce the administrative and clerical burden to common carriers when licensing vehicles, boats, aircraft, or railroad buffet cars, via a modification of the current licensing requirements for beverage dispensary licenses. SB 215 would simplify the current licensing process for the Alcoholic Beverage Control Board, and at the same time, reduce fees to licensees to more accurately reflect the actual costs to the Board of issuing licenses.
